Pistachio by DS&Durga presents a surprisingly complex and divisive interpretation of its namesake ingredient. While some users detect a subtle, creamy, roasted nutty accord that evokes raw pistachio or a smooth vanilla pistachio paste, many others perceive it as heavily dominated by patchouli—described as earthy, woody, and medicinal—overwhelming the nutty character entirely. The scent evolves from an initial bold, patchouli-heavy core to a softer, slightly sweet dry down with hints of vanilla and cardamom, though the transformation isn’t universal. A thin sillage and moderate longevity are reported across most skin types, with some noting fade faster than expected. Despite the name and visual appeal, the perfume often fails to deliver a true gourmand pistachio experience, leaning more toward a savory, woody, and aromatic profile than sweet or confectionary. It wears best in cooler weather and is widely seen as a unique, wearable scent for those appreciating abstract or earthy fragrances, even if it doesn't fully honor its name.
